The entire front bumper is different.
The steering wheel is different.
The 06's have the new airbag technology
The seats are different colored (more black then red)
They added an Apearence package for the 06 wich includes vortex generator, sunroof deflector and muffler tip.
Asside fromt that, everything else is the same

The 2004 and 2005 are almost identical. The only diff. I am aware of is the downpipe is different, and the 2005 is a bolt on connection with the CAT where the 2004 is welded.
As far as appearance, I believe they are identical.
The 2006 model is different appearance-wise (see Ralli04Art's post), but I believe the exact same performance wise as previous.
Product life cycle with Mitsu is typically 5 years....so I won't expect many changes besides appearance before the 2009 model.

1. Different material on the seats, same seats (not as much red, though there is still a little bit. The new 06 material doesn't pick up dalmation hair so damn bad as the 04/05).
2. Different place for the hazard switch (I said VERY minor

3. A new airbag deactivation thing; The passenger bag won't deploy if there is no one in the seat or a light person in the seat. To save wasting a $1000+ airbag module if it's not needed AND to save against killing a 40 pound kid. There is a little light where the hazard switch used to be telling you if the passenger bag is deactivated.
4. Brushed metal pedals are standard on all manual trans 2006 RAs.
That is all the interior changes I can think of. The grill and air dam are the only exterior changes. The hood is the same.
Some hate that bar thing on the 2006 bumper. The fix is to get a black 06, I don't even notice the bar thing anymore and actually don't mind it. The grill is 10 times better. It has a honeycomb look instead of the Pontiac nose thing.
